85. To ask the Minister for Education and Skills further to Parliamentary Question No. 255 of 26 September 2023, the updates on the claim lodged by an organisation (details supplied) in regard to recognising incremental credit for private post primary teaching service outside the EU; the advice given by her Department to the organisation on this matter; if other relevant updates in relation to this matter will be provided; and if she will make a statement on the matter. [54210/23]

Photo of Norma FoleyNorma Foley (Kerry, Fianna Fail)
Link to this: Individually | In context | Oireachtas source

As set out in my response to Parliamentary Question No. 255 of 26 September 2023, the teacher unions have lodged a claim concerning the recognition of private post primary teaching service outside the EU towards the award of incremental credit.

My Department examined this request as part of the 2024 budgetary process. However, it was not possible to secure funding to progress this request through the 2024 budgetary process.

My Department was however successful in securing funding for a number of other important initiatives aimed at teachers such as the restoration of 1,000 posts of responsibility and the PME incentive scheme.

My Department will continue to examine ways in which the matter may be progressed in the future.
